These 1873 Pre-33 $20 Liberty Double Eagle Gold Coins are certified at Mint State 63. MS63 examples display light impairments to the original mint luster and numerous small contact marks, sometimes in the main focal areas, with a few heavier marks scattered across the coin.
Obverse
The obverse of the 1873 Pre-33 Liberty Double Eagle Coin shows Liberty facing left, wearing a coronet with the word LIBERTY inscribed. A circle of 13 stars surrounds her image, representing the original states. Beneath her portrait, the year of issue is included, serving as the date mark. Inscriptions include LIBERTY and 1873.
Reverse
The reverse of the 1873 $20 Liberty Double Eagle Gold Coin displays the Great Seal of the United States. This heraldic image features a bald eagle with a shield on its chest. The eagles talons hold both arrows and an olive branch. This Type II reverse version includes the motto IN GOD WE TRUST above the eagle and the inscription TWENTY D. as the denomination. Additional inscriptions read UNITED STATES OF AMERICA.
History
During 1873, Philadelphia, Carson City, and San Francisco struck Liberty Double Eagles, with more than 2.7 million coins combined. Philadelphia struck the largest share, over 1.7 million pieces, while San Francisco produced more than 1 million. The coins featured here are Open 3 coins, so named for the wider, more open shape of the numeral 3 in the date on certain dies.
